My Friends, 

Be it a testament of my love for Vintage Story, that I break from the throes of gaming hedonism in order to share my most humble of suggestions: I want to stay drunk longer.

So passionate am I about this, I did math! With a jug of wine, bucket of wine, a liter of distilled brandy, and a stopwatch. The jug (3L) got me decently drunk for about a minute of playtime (then 30 seconds of light intoxication). 1L of distilled brandy was over 3 minutes (with some noticeable effects after). For the effort, and for the verisimilitude, the laughs, and especially any multiplayer camaraderie after long days of distilling, let the good times roll!

I'm not asking for My Summer Car, where 3L of homebrew could have you drunk for the rest of the in-game day (and shaking in the morning). But should the patch notes ever read that intoxication time has been extended (especially for distilled spirits), know that you would have made this player happy.

Perhaps it's useful to compare the ingame timescale. At default settings, an ingame hour is two IRL minutes. So being completely smashed for over 3 IRL minutes would mean being completely smashed for 1-2 hours ingame.
